Checking compressor ratios is an
excellent way to check system
performance and possible failures.
Run the vehicle at 1500 RPM and
record both gauge readings then
add 15PSI to your reading.
1. Hub/armature and rotor/pulley
drive faces have oil or grease on
them.
Example:
35PSI plus 15=50(low)
235PSI plus 15=250(high)
250:50= 5 to 1 ratio

Tech Tip: Proper air gap between
the clutch pulley and hub armature
is critical to compressor overall
performance. Failure to maintain
the proper spacing, as indicated in
the mfgrs. specifications can lead
to problems such as clutch burning
or slippage.

If a systems exceeds these ratios
the compressor may fail to high
internal pressure on the pistons
and swash plates.
Possible causes of high ratios are
refrigerant overcharges and air in
the system. Recover /recharge,
vacuum, and identify source
of excess air. (Use refrigerant
identifier to check equipment,
tanks, and system)

TROUBLESHOOTING
CLUTCH SLIPPING
1. Low torque problem. Cycle
on/off between 2500- 3000 RPM
for 50 cycles to burnish the hub
and rotor.
2. Low voltage at the field coil.
Check for wiring shorts, poor
connections, and defective
relays.
3. Compressor is seized or tight.
Check torque specs. Repair or
replace.
4. High system pressures. Check
compressor oil levels. Excess
oil can slug compressor. Low oil
will cause binding. Condenser
restrictions from blockage or
improper fan operation will reduce
air flow and raise discharge
pressures.
5. High heat coming from clutch
bearing will produce loose grease
and then bearing failure.
NOISY CLUTCH
1. Check belt size, tension, and
alignment.
2. Rotor dragging. Air gap is
too small. Reset and shim if
necessary.
3. Wrong coil snap ring and installed
wrong. Repair or replace.
4. Field assembly installed
incorrect. Make sure it is bottomed
completely on shoulder. Pilot
diameter is worn undersized. The
field shell pilot is worn oversize.
Replace compressor and or/
assembly. The bearing is damaged.
Replace clutch.

CLUTCH DOESN’T ENGAGE
1. The air gap is excessive. Reset
and remove shims.
2. Voltage at coil isn’t 10.8. Poor
connection, shorts, relays, or
charging system.
3. Resistance problem at coil.
Shorted or open coil so replace and
diagnose electrical problems

CLUTCH FAILS TO DISENGAGE
1. Clearance between the hub
and rotor is too close. Shim to
increase.
2. Rotor snap ring missing or
installed wrong. Repair or
replace.
3. The air gap is too small. Reset
and add shims.
4. Clutch engages without turning
on a/c. Diagnose electrical problem
and repair.

Manufacturers have changed their part numbers indicating upgrades
to R-134a. They use HNBR/neoprene materials, larger bearings,
improved oil passages, and modifications for piston/swash plate designs.
A few models will have to be replaced during retrofit.
